I suspect what's causing this is the web torrent has been updated but
the local hashes *aren't*, or generally a mismatch between whatever the
hashes transmission is using and the stuff the webtorrent is sending.
Other internet archive torrents warn that this will fail to download
properly, but it's *still a bug* on transmission's side since this
behaviour of just DDoSing the swarm by continually downloading and
discarding pieces is a not very nice behaviour
